Converting a layout to Block Detection

I’ve got a medium sized layout (18’ x 12’), that I want to add detection to (with the Digitrax BDL168) and I have to break the layout into blocks (cutting the one rail). And I’m kinda clueless about where to locate the blocks. Does anyone have a suggestion as to where to start. I’m eventually going to add signalling and the Winlok software as well for full automation. Any information would be fantastic !

Start by figuring out where your automation software would NEED to know if there was a train present or not. Usually the same locations of the standard DC control blocks would be a good place to start. The smaller the blocks the finer control of the trains will be possible. Also since you are going this route, make certain all the mobile decoders for the locomotives have transponding. Then the computer won’t just know there is a train in the block but can also know the identity of the decoder (locomotive).

I am assuming that there is currently only one power block on the layout. Our club layout got into trouble because with purchased the BDL168 units not realizing that all the sections they were to detect had to be on the same “power” supply.
